Mar 02, 2020 · Touro University's learning management system, Canvas, is at the center of many instructional technology activities. Canvas enhances teaching and learning by providing students with improved access to assignments, course materials and grades; while making communication with students, tracking student progress, and grading easier for faculty.

How to use a microphone on Mac?

Users on Mac OS X 10.5 and earlier must select a microphone option: 1 Single Talker: Headset or a microphone just for yourself. 2 Multiple Talkers: Single microphone for multiple talkers, such as when you are in a meeting room with others. This is the default.

Can you use a microphone on a computer?

You can use your computer's built-in microphone and speakers. You can also add additional devices or use a headset that combines both the speaker and microphone devices. You can join a session early to run the wizard. If you run it again during a session, you cannot hear any of the session's audio.
